Buying Guide for the Best Ryzen Motherboard

Choosing the right motherboard for your Ryzen processor is crucial as it determines the compatibility, performance, and features of your entire system. A motherboard connects all the components of your computer, so it's important to pick one that meets your needs and supports your processor. Here are the key specifications to consider when selecting a Ryzen motherboard.
ChipsetThe chipset is a crucial part of the motherboard that determines its capabilities and compatibility with your Ryzen processor. Different chipsets offer varying levels of performance, features, and connectivity options. For example, high-end chipsets like X570 offer more PCIe lanes, better overclocking support, and more USB ports, while budget chipsets like A320 provide basic functionality. Choose a chipset that matches your performance needs and the features you require.

Form FactorThe form factor of a motherboard determines its size and the type of case it will fit into. Common form factors include ATX, Micro-ATX, and Mini-ITX. ATX motherboards are larger and offer more expansion slots and features, while Micro-ATX and Mini-ITX are smaller and more compact, suitable for smaller cases. Choose a form factor that fits your case and meets your expansion needs.

Expansion Slots and PortsExpansion slots and ports determine the connectivity and expandability of your system. Look for the number and type of PCIe slots for graphics cards and other expansion cards, as well as USB ports, SATA ports for storage devices, and M.2 slots for NVMe SSDs. More slots and ports provide greater flexibility for adding components and peripherals. Choose a motherboard with the right balance of slots and ports for your current and future needs.
Power Delivery and VRM QualityPower delivery and VRM (Voltage Regulator Module) quality are important for stable and efficient power supply to the CPU, especially if you plan to overclock. A motherboard with a robust VRM design ensures better power management and stability under load. Look for motherboards with good VRM cooling solutions and higher phase counts for better performance and reliability. If you plan to overclock, prioritize motherboards with strong power delivery systems.
BIOS and FirmwareThe BIOS (Basic Input/Output System) and firmware of a motherboard control its basic functions and compatibility with hardware. A user-friendly BIOS with regular updates ensures better compatibility with new processors and features. Some motherboards offer advanced BIOS options for overclocking and fine-tuning system performance. Choose a motherboard with a reliable BIOS and good manufacturer support for updates.
Audio and NetworkingAudio and networking features can enhance your overall computing experience. Integrated audio solutions vary in quality, with some motherboards offering high-definition audio codecs for better sound quality. Networking options include Ethernet ports and, in some cases, built-in Wi-Fi. Consider your audio and networking needs and choose a motherboard that offers the features you require for a seamless experience.
